The Subaru Impreza 1.6 AT (100 hp) 4x4 is a versatile and dependable station wagon that combines practicality with performance. Produced between 1992 and 2000, this Japanese-made vehicle has earned a reputation for its durability, all-wheel-drive capability, and spacious design. Whether you're navigating city streets or venturing off-road, the Impreza delivers a balanced driving experience that appeals to families and adventure enthusiasts alike.
Under the hood, the Impreza features a 1.6-liter petrol engine with a power output of 100 hp at 6000 rpm and a torque of 138 N*m at 4500 rpm. The engine's opposed-cylinder layout ensures smooth operation and reduced vibrations, while the distributed injection system optimizes fuel efficiency. With a combined fuel consumption of 8.4 liters per 100 km, this car strikes a balance between performance and economy. The 4-speed automatic transmission and full-time all-wheel drive provide excellent traction and control, making it a reliable choice for various driving conditions.
The Impreza's station wagon body type offers ample space for both passengers and cargo. With a length of 4350 mm, a width of 1690 mm, and a height of 1440 mm, it provides a comfortable interior without compromising on maneuverability. The trunk volume ranges from 365 liters to an impressive 1280 liters when the rear seats are folded, making it ideal for road trips or hauling gear. The ground clearance of 165 mm ensures that the car can handle rough terrain with ease, further enhancing its versatility.
Inside, the Impreza is designed with practicality in mind. The independent spring suspension on both the front and rear ensures a smooth ride, even on uneven surfaces. Ventilated front disc brakes and rear drum brakes provide reliable stopping power, while the car's sturdy construction and all-wheel-drive system contribute to its safety credentials. The 5-door configuration allows for easy access, making it a convenient choice for families or those who frequently transport passengers.
